WritingOnTheWallsOfTheCanvas_LondonsFirstHappyCafe_04:03:15Billing itself as London’s first ‘Happy Café’, The Canvas in Shoreditch has relaunched as a place for city dwellers to ‘seek comfort’ (as well as yoga classes, documentary screenings, courses, workshops… and even food). Originally founded by Ruth Rogers in October last year, The Canvas has teamed up with Action for Happiness charity to host events and workshops aimed at improving confidence, self-esteem and well-being in the capital.

It is London’s first cafe to be supported by Action for Happiness as a space for Londoners to explore what matters for a happy and meaningful life. Catch inspirational TED Talks on Tuesdays; yoga classes on Wednesdays; free weekend screenings of documentaries in The

Canvas’ basement cinema; a free ‘Happiness Boosters’ workshop run by the charity Inner Space, and an 8-week course in Happiness, commencing this month run by Action for Happiness.

The first Happy Café was launched in Brighton in October 2014. The Canvas is supported by Investec as part of its Beyond Business Programme in partnership with Bromley by Bow Centre. It is a programme that launches and aids social enterprises from budding entrepreneurs in Tower Hamlets, Hackney and Newham.
